Depending on how badly your heads are cracked, it can be much cheaper to find some other heads. My motor has repaired heads and they are fine. The cracks that I had were from plug to seat only. If the cracks are worse than that the money starts adding up. You must also consider the cost of seats, guides, springs, valves, and machining. My rule of thumb for heads is around $150 per chamber on average. That's a mid line figure. I have spent much less and much more on some heads.
